I am not even completely ramped up yet and I am already noticing a big difference and have seen an improvement in lung functions. I have went 4 months without being to the CF clinic (knocking on wood) my appointment is in a couple weeks and if I make it to that one without getting sick it will eb the longest I have ever went without getting an exacerbation.
Now to be fair I am also taking xolair to get my IGE levels down from 3-400 level due to ABPA. However, the two of them in combination are really helpign with my allergies. The end result is the reduction in IGE and that will happen with allergy treatment regardless of if you have to take xolair too or not.
I cant say enough about it, evne if it wasnt helping my lungs my quality of life is higher without all the crap running down back of my throat and the super sinus headaches constantly. I know it's a PITA but worth it IMO.
